I can't tell by the pics alone but that looks like water spots on the wrapper. Nothing to worry about at all. This is caused by tiny spots of water being on the wrapper when it is drying in the sun. If it is mold, which I doubt it is, it will simply wipe off. If it does not wipe off it is a water spot and you can smoke away.
Also most of the time mold growing on a wrapper is white not green. ![]() |
